Output 64255eaee95b0454da019c288ce2a6a89ef2ad97e672c3ddadfebcce5ea3f5e8:0

value
266373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6983e8aa9b4a62389fe4b4f91875664ac9a06263 OP_EQUAL
address
3BJvtsdYRS2u9ZY5rfBqLSfMeKj96J2117
transaction
64255eaee95b0454da019c288ce2a6a89ef2ad97e672c3ddadfebcce5ea3f5e8
spent
true